The high - molecular-weight phthalate polymers; CAP, HPMCP and PVAP, are polymers modified by esterification with ortho-phthalic acid groups. The phthalates restricted from toys and food articles in the EU due to evidence of endocrine disruption, have been the low -molecular weight ortho- phthalates.

The purity of DEP can achieve 99% or greater using current manufacturing processes (HSDB, 2009). The remaining fraction of the DEP commercial mixture can also contain impurities such as isophthalic, terephthalic acid, and maleic anhydride (Harris et al., 1997; ATSDR, 1995).

Background. Diethyl phthalate (DEP) is widely used in many commercially available products including plastics and personal care products. DEP has generally not been found to share the antiandrogenic mode of action that is common among other types of phthalates, but there is emerging evidence that DEP may be associated with other types of health effects.

- What is diethyl phthalate?
- Diethyl phthalate is a chemical compound is a diethyl ester of phthalic acid that belongs to the phthalate ester family. It is a clear, colourless liquid that is slightly denser than water and has low volatility. It is commonly synthesized via the Oxo or Ald-Ox processes and is also known as phthalol or solvanol.

- What does diethyl phthalate taste like?
- Diethyl phthalate is produced in the reaction of phthalic anhydride with ethanol in the presence of concentrated sulphuric acid catalyst. Clear, colorless, oily liquid with a mild, chemical odor. Bitter taste. Virtually odorless when pure ("Perfumery grade" of commercial Diethyl phthalate). Very bitter taste in weak hydro-alcoholic solution.
- What is the phthalate removal efficiency of DEHP?
- Global phthalate removal The WWTP average removal efficiency for DEHP was 78% from May 22 to 28, 2006 ( Table 3 ). A similar DEHP elimination ratio (75%) was observed in Canada with the same treatment device ( Fernandez et al., 2007 ).
